Form 4: Howard Hughes Holdings Director Anthony Williams Reports Stock Transactions

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4


Director Anthony Williams reports acquiring and disposing of Howard Hughes Holdings Inc. (HHH) common stock.

Summary

  • On May 28, 2024, Director Anthony Williams disposed of 311 shares of Howard Hughes Holdings Inc. common stock at a price of $64.75 per share.
  • On June 14, 2024, Williams acquired 2,154 shares of common stock.
  • As of June 14, 2024, following these transactions, Williams beneficially owns 6,831 shares of Howard Hughes Holdings Inc. common stock directly.
  • The 2,154 shares acquired on June 14, 2024, represent restricted stock granted to non-employee directors under the company's 2020 Equity Incentive Plan.
  • These shares will vest on the earlier of the 2025 annual meeting of stockholders or June 1, 2025.
